I just used SPL Meter on my iPhone to measure the sound volume during cold start and after cold start at idle:

- cold start: ~98 dB
- after cold start, idle: ~82 dB

I was standing about 4 feet from the back of the car pointing the phone mic at the exhaust.

So it's loud but not annoyingly loud to me. I can definitely hear it from within the house but the family or neighbors never complained (but I don't usually leave the house very early.)

For comparison sake my X5 xDrive50i with M perf package has a cold start volume of ~91 dB.
